SHe was formed in late 2008 by a group of friends in Washington, D.C., who wanted a meaningful alternative to large single's activities like cruises or other events. This group created the Singular Humanitarian experience (SHe)—a volunteer-run organization with a two-fold mission: facilitate meaningful and unforgettable opportunities for singles to serve together anywhere in the world and provide sustainable humanitarian development projects.
SHe volunteers are principally, but not exclusively, single members of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ints in their mid-20s to late 30s who are interested in using their talents, skills, and time to provide significant service as well as enrich their lives through personal and cultural interactions.
SHe's inaugural expedition to Nepal in November 2010 brought together 40 volunteers for eight days. The group participated in a multi-faceted project serving the Nepali people in the remote Lamjung District in the foothills of the Himalayas.
SHe worked together with CHOICE Humanitarian, a 501(c)3 non-profit organization with more than 20 years of experience in combating poverty by focusing on sustainable village development in Nepal.
